Virginia Supreme Court blocks redistricting referendum and invalidates new congressional map

Source: Washington Examiner
The Supreme Court of Virginia invalidated a voter-approved redistricting referendum on Friday, ruling that lawmakers failed to follow the constitutional process required to place the measure on the ballot and halting Democrat-led efforts to implement a new congressional map.
The majority held that lawmakers acted too late when they approved the amendment proposal after more than a million early ballots had already been cast in last years Virginia elections, according to the decision released Friday morning. The state constitution requires the legislature to vote on any proposed constitutional amendments in two stages with an election in between to give voters the opportunity to hold their representatives accountable if they dont like the proposed amendment, and the state Supreme Court found that Virginia Democrats did not follow that process.
The decision resolves a high-stakes legal fight over whether the Democrat-controlled General Assembly complied with the Virginia Constitution when it moved to place the amendment before voters in a special election last month, and means Virginia will keep the map that is favorable to Republicans in five of its congressional districts.

(5,492 posts)The states highest court ruled on Friday that the legislatures process for pursuing the new map violated Virginias Constitution and ordered that an earlier version be used in the upcoming midterm elections.
The decision marks a significant milestone in an escalating effort by the major US political parties to maximize partisan advantages ahead of the November vote by redrawing congressional districts. The Democrat-led Virginia plan came in response to a redistricting effort by Republicans in Texas last year supported by President Donald Trump.
The panel upheld a ruling from a Tazewell County judge who sided with Republican state lawmakers and declared the redistricting effort unlawful. Democratic state officials could next ask the US Supreme Court to intervene on an emergency basis. In recent months, the US justices allowed new congressional maps to remain in effect in Texas and later in California for the midterm election.
